Hi Karen, Thanks for your question; Disney Vacation Club is one of my favorite topics to talk about! The decision to invest in the DVC is a huge financial decision, so you are smart to do your homework before making the leap! We purchased DVC with the intention of visiting at least once per year. At the time I was pregnant with our first child, so our early visits were in a studio or one bedroom. Since that time we have added two more children to our family so we always opt for the extra space of the 2-br villas. For us this is critical, as we tend to have longer stays and spend a fair amount of time at the resort.
For my family, traveling off-peak has always been a priority so I have never had an issue securing the reservations that I want, and I typically book at the seven month window. My little plug…Having the laundry and the full kitchen is probably the biggest perks for us. The washer and dryer allow for me to pack lighter, which is incredibly helpful when traveling with small children. The kitchen is my biggest cost saving measure, as we grocery shop and prepare at least 1-2 meals in our villa. We buy a case of bottled water and juice to store in the fridge and take with us to the parks. For us, having foods available that are healthy and familiar to our children really helps their overall behavior and reduces the stress and expense of dining out for every meal. Disney has become a very “easy” vacation for us, so we visit at least 2-3 times per year. Even after eight years of membership we still experiencing new things on every trip. It is quality family time for us, and since kids are only little once it is a perfect opportunity for us to go on family friendly vacations! I have always called it an investment in our family and it’s the best one we’ve made!
